Output e3bda6bb717771fac1ae5cc23712b4ef5a7683fe1d1eaf725f953b9e585c25d3:28

value
6683213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57f340d55a78e025610e96a54827041f4b06cd8 OP_EQUAL
address
MTN2YXppkeWAJuXrQC9wkQ7wXaP7jrS5yX
transaction
e3bda6bb717771fac1ae5cc23712b4ef5a7683fe1d1eaf725f953b9e585c25d3
spent
true